    Some interesting thoughts on Notts’ latest signings from NTT20:

    Oliver Norburn (CM)- [Blackpool - Notts County] - Free

    A captain almost everywhere he’s been, the experienced Ollie Norburn drops below League One for the first time in seven years to join Notts County. Norburn was injured at the back end of last season while on loan at Wigan, so he may take a while to get going at Meadow Lane, but he almost certainly has all the pedigree, quality, and character to play a huge role next season.

    That could be important. In big moments, especially at the back end of 2024/25, County have looked in desperate need of a big character such as Norburn. He could make a real impact.

    Maziar Kouhyar (LW) - [York - Notts County] - Free

    It may be something of a surprise to see Kouhyar, 27, return to the EFL. Last seen in these parts with Walsall in 2018/19, he dropped down into non-league after his career was blighted by injury. But… we think we like this one.

    Kouhyar ranks highly in the National League North/South for progressive runs, penalty-box entries, dribbles, pass accuracy and goal contributions. He started 35 games in 24/25, scoring 12 league goals and putting on 6 assists. Those injuries look to be behind him, and he gives County a creative outlet out wide.

    Kouhyar is a great age. He’s got a great backstory. He’ll have the bit between his teeth. And, because he’s an Afghanistan international, County now have enough players to postpone games due to international call-ups if they want to next season.
